
TP钱包(TPwallet)若要“创建自己的”实现路线,核心并不止于界面仿制,而是围绕交易生命周期、链间资产一致性与可验证的安全策略构建一套可扩展系统。本文以研究视角拆解方法:先把“钱包=签名与密钥管理+交易路由+状态同步”的本质拆开,再把多链复杂度逐层并入工程实现。为避免把产品仅视作应用层,本研究将其上升为工程化的交易基础设施:用高效交易系统保证吞吐与确定性,用多链资产互通解决资产状态跨链的一致性,用多链交易管理统一订单与回执,用多链兼容降低链差异摩擦,并在新兴技术应用与便携管理之间建立闭环。
高效交易系统的关键在于“预估—打包—签名—广播—确认”的流水线。工程上可采用异步队列与批处理策略,将gas估算、nonce获取、路径选择与签名操作解耦;同时通过本地缓存与链上读写分离减少RPC抖动对用户感知的影响。交易吞吐与稳定性可参考公开研究与行业实践:EIP-1559机制下,费用市场动态变化使得链上确认时间呈波动,前端或路由层需要自适应策略。关于费用与交易机制的规范,可参照以太坊相关提案与文档(如 EIP-1559,出处:Ethereum Improvement Proposals,https://eips.ethereum.org)。
多链资产互通涉及跨链“资产表述”的一致性问题:同一资产在不同链可能对应不同合约/包装形式。若采取跨链桥或原生互操作协议,钱包层需维护映射关系(token address、decimals、链ID、合约类型)并把“最小可用额度”与“手续费归因”显式化。进一步,跨链的风险模型(合约可用性、桥合约状态、最终性差异)应当在交易管理层以策略约束表达:例如在高度不确定的网络条件下限制自动路由或降低自动重试强度。
多链交易管理可被视为“统一账本的执行层”。钱包需要对同一用户意图形成可追踪的交易图:包括路由选择、审批/授权(如ERC-20授权)、交换路径、失败重试与回执归档。研究中可采用事件溯源(event sourcing)思想:把交易状态变化(created/signed/broadcasted/pending/confirmed/failed)作为不可变事件流;这样便携管理端(多设备同步)才能在断网或更换设备后恢复一致状态。与之相配套,多链兼容应通过适配器模式将链特定逻辑封装:如不同签名算法、nonce模型、确认规则、地址格式校验。

新兴技术应用可从两条主线推进:其一是安全与隐私,如引入硬件隔离式签名(如TEE或硬件钱包通道)与风险评分(模拟交易、slippage与权限变更检测)。其二是效率与可验证性,如采用状态通道、聚合签名或利用轻客户端验证减少对中心化RPC的依赖。关于轻客户端与验证思路,可参考相关学术综述与区块链可验证轻量客户端讨论(例如关于轻客户端验证的研究,方向包括“light client verification”与“consensus verification”,可在arXiv检索对应关键词)。
便携管理强调跨端一致性。将密钥与交易历史分层:密钥永不出端,交易历史/状态通过加密同步。实现时可将“意图层”与“执行层”分离:意图(用户要交换/转账/跨链)可在不同设备重放或撤销,而执行细节在服务端不可篡改地记录或由客户端可验证地重建。创新科技发展因此不只是“更多链”,而是通过模块化架构让新链接入成本可控:链适配器、估价器、路由器与状态同步器遵循统一接口。
总体而言,自建TP钱包类产品的工程研究可归结为:把交易流水线做快,把跨链映射与风险策略做严,把多链状态与回执做统一,把链差异做抽象,并让便携管理在离线与多端场景下保持确定性。实现这些目标时,需以可审计的日志、可复现的交易构建与基于规范的链交互为原则,从而达到“高效、互通、可控、兼容与可扩展”的全方位能力。
评论